Facebook stops building drones that would have provided wireless internet to the developing world, will instead focus on developing underlying technology
- The revelation comes after Business Insider reported on upheaval at the Aquila project, including the departure of its leader and a planned redesign.
Context & Ripple Effects
Facebook's aerial connectivity program has been unwinding piece by piece: it had already scrapped a secret $500 million satellite plan in 2015, even as it flew the solar-powered Aquila drone through a full-scale prototype with a 10-gigabit laser link and an inaugural test flight in 2016.
The end of drone manufacturing follows reported upheaval inside the Aquila project, including its leader's departure and a planned redesign — and it lands alongside Facebook's parallel bet on OpenCellular, its open-source wireless access platform whose hardware plans are free to researchers and manufacturers.
